Table 2 of Brézin, Mol Vis 2011; 17:1669-1678.
Patient | Age | Visual acuity | Main clinical findings |
---|---|---|---|
II.1 and III.2 | Reported to be blind at an early age, secondary to RDs | ||
III.4* | 82 | NLP / NLP | OD: RD, Prosthesis OS: Aphakic, glaucoma, retinis pigmentosa-like fundus |
IV.2 | 64 | NLP / LP in 1 quadrant | OD: Aphakic, phtisis bulba, RD at age 33, retinis pigmentosa-like fundus, vitreous veils OS: RD at age 11, Prosthesis |
IV.4 | 63 | NLP / NLP | OD: RD at age 3, Prosthesis OS: Aphakic, phtisis bulba |
IV.6 | 60 | 0.2 / NLP | OD:Pseudophakic OS: Cataract, glaucoma (2 trabeculectomies), prosthesis Chorioretinal atrophy, pigment clumping, vitreous strands |
IV.7 | 57 | 0.5 / NLP | OD: Aphakic OS: RD at age 7, phtisis bulba, diffuse band keratopathy, nasally stretched retinal vessels, temporal pigmented lesions |
IV.8 | 46 | HM / 0.5 | OU: Pseudophakic Chorioretinal atrophy, diffuse pigment clumping |
IV.9 | 46 | NLP / 0.6 | OD: RD at age 7, prosthesis OS: Pseudophakic peripheral cryotherapy and laser scars |
V.2 | 31 | 0.4 / 0.25 | OD: Pseudophakic, RD at age 13 OS: vitreoretinal exudative manifestations, RD at age 9 OU: Nasally stretched retinal vessels, pigment clumping, ectopic faveae, no vitreous strands |
V.5 | 29 | 0.6/0.4 | OU: Repetitive anterior uveitis with synechiae Retinal vascular abnormalities, peripheral exudates in temporal retina, pigment clumping, vitreous fold parallel to the ora |
V.6 | 36 | 0.6/NLP | OS: Aphakic, RD at age 6, chorioretinal atrophy, pseudo-retinis pigmentosa OD: Pigment clumping, retinal atrophy in the peripapillary area and along the temporal vascular arcades, no vitreous strands |
